Amazon's top-of-the-line E Ink e-reader was slightly updated in -- but this Kindle e-reader device is basically identical to the previous Kindle Oasis except for one key difference: It has a new color-adjustable integrated light that allows you to customize the color tone from cool to warm, depending on whether you're reading during the day or at night.
You can also schedule the screen warmth to update automatically with sunrise and sunset -- not unlike Night Shift mode on Apple devices. Most people will be happy with the more affordable Paperwhite for their Kindle ebook reading, but if you want the best of the best with an anti-glare screen for your reading experience -- and don't mind paying a premium for it -- the Oasis is arguably the one.

In other words, if you get your ebooks -- or any other digital documents -- from any place besides Amazon, this device is a Kindle alternative that will probably read them.
The Kobo device has its own ebook store with thousands of books, and it has built-in support for checking out ebooks from local libraries via the OverDrive service. You can get library books onto Kindles via OverDrive's Libby app , but it's not as smooth a process. Available in black or white, you can use the Kobo Libra in portrait or landscape mode. One of the main advantages that e-readers have over printed books is the size and portability of the devices. In comparison to laptop computers, e-readers are cheaper and tend to optimize battery life. The display of specialized e-reader devices also tends to optimize readability.
